Mis mejores consejos para aprender, mantenerse motivado y lograr sus objetivos

Una de las preguntas más comunes que me hacen es cómo logré encontrar tiempo para aprender desarrollo web y cambiar totalmente de carrera, mientras trabajaba a tiempo completo y con una familia joven en casa.
Diablos, ¡incluso me pregunto eso a veces!
De manera similar, estas son también algunas de las excusas más comunes que escucho de por qué las personas no pueden aprender, por qué las personas se rinden y por qué no progresan más en sus carreras.
Ahora, aprecio que todos tengamos diferentes estilos de vida, compromisos, motivaciones y ciertamente no tengo la respuesta definitiva. Pero quiero compartir algunas de mis lecciones y consejos clave: para encontrar el tiempo para aprender, mantenerse motivado y alcanzar sus metas.
No permita que la falta de tiempo percibida le impida alcanzar sus sueños y sus metas.
Profundo y estrecho
Este parece un lugar lógico para comenzar. Es posible que tenga una idea aproximada de lo que quiere o necesita aprender. ¿Pero ha elegido cuidadosamente algunos recursos y un camino definitivo que va a seguir?
Por lo general, la respuesta es un rotundo "NO".
Yo era exactamente el mismo. Como la mayoría de las personas, cuando comencé a aprender sobre desarrollo web, realmente no tenía demasiado plan. Lo que resultó en esto fue que perdí innumerables horas aprendiendo un poco de esto, un poco de aquello, y no llegué a ninguna parte.
El tiempo es precioso, especialmente con los muchos compromisos y obstáculos que la vida a menudo pone en nuestro camino. Por lo tanto, debe asegurarse de aprovechar al máximo cada segundo del poco tiempo que tiene.
Esto significa crear un plan de aprendizaje, un plan de estudios y respetarlo. Pero también puede maximizar el retorno de su inversión de tiempo reduciendo lo que está aprendiendo en lugar de aprender sin rumbo fijo un poco de todo.
Por lo tanto, si su objetivo es trabajar por cuenta propia y crear sitios web para pequeñas empresas locales, puede decidir que desea aprender WordPress. Si este es el caso, simplemente hágalo. Aprenda WordPress y sus tecnologías asociadas y aprendalas bien. ¡Ve al fondo!
Concéntrese en convertirse en un “experto” de WordPress en lugar de distraerse aprendiendo Laravel o el último marco de JavaScript.
De manera similar, si su objetivo es ingresar al desarrollo de software a nivel empresarial, aprender WordPress no será una forma inteligente de gastar el poco tiempo que tiene.
Eso no quiere decir que no valga la pena aprender ninguna de estas tecnologías, o que no pueda aprender y expandir su conjunto de habilidades en el futuro. Solo que si su objetivo es conseguir un empleo, obtener una promoción o crear un producto, en el menor tiempo posible, entonces necesita maximizar su tiempo y concentrar su esfuerzo en las cosas que lo llevarán allí más rápido.
La consistencia es clave
Esto tiene que ser lo más importante que he aprendido y el mejor consejo que podría dar a cualquiera que esté aprendiendo algo.
Descubrí que aprender algo no se trata tanto de la cantidad de tiempo invertido, sino de la coherencia.
Por ejemplo, si solo tienes 10 horas de tiempo libre cada semana para dedicarlas al aprendizaje, aprenderás y retendrás más si estudias durante 90 minutos, los 7 días de la semana, ¡en lugar de intentar acumular 10 horas en un fin de semana!
¿No suena también 90 minutos diarios como una meta mucho más alcanzable? ¡Es mucho más fácil levantarse una hora antes o irse a la cama una hora más tarde que renunciar a todo el fin de semana!
Se trata de formar un hábito y hacer del aprendizaje parte de tu estilo de vida.
Como humanos, somos criaturas de hábitos. Así que convierta el aprendizaje en parte de su rutina diaria, dedique tiempo, sea constante y continúe.
Hacer sacrificios
Como se mencionó, necesita hacer tiempo y debe ser constante al hacerlo. Esto podría significar que debe hacer sacrificios para lograr ese objetivo.
Ya sea que esto signifique sacrificar una hora en la cama, no terminar el libro que acaba de comenzar o perderse su programa de televisión favorito, esto es lo que debe hacer. Nunca dije que sería fácil ...
… Sin embargo, ¿lo importante a recordar aquí? ¡No es para siempre!
Este es un sacrificio a corto plazo para lograr su objetivo a largo plazo.
Para mí, como trabajaba muchas horas y tenía dos hijos menores de 3 años, decidí que mi tiempo de aprendizaje sería a partir de las 9 pm, una vez que los niños estuvieran en la cama. Este habría sido antes el momento en que me sentaba y miraba televisión con mi esposa y me relajaba después de un día duro. En cambio, a menudo me quedaba despierto hasta la madrugada, dormía lo mínimo y me levantaba temprano para trabajar al día siguiente.
Ese fue el sacrificio que hice ... pero ahora, al hacer ese sacrificio en el corto plazo y lograr mi objetivo de conseguir un trabajo en el desarrollo web, ya no tengo que hacer ese sacrificio. Trabajo 8 horas en mi trabajo diario, regreso a casa y puedo ver toda la televisión de mierda que quiero.
Lo curioso es que todavía paso las 9 de la noche en adelante y me quedo hasta muy tarde, aprendiendo cosas nuevas y trabajando en proyectos paralelos. ¡Es curioso cómo ese 'sacrificio' constante pronto se convirtió en un hábito!
Reconoce tu motivación
La perspectiva es algo maravilloso. Para algunas personas, tener una esposa y una familia joven puede ser la razón por la que no pueden aprender a codificar. La razón por la que no tienes tiempo.
Para mí, esta fue mi motivación.
Decidí que quería una carrera más estable, con un futuro más brillante y la posibilidad de un mejor equilibrio entre el trabajo y la vida (¡a quién engañaba!). En última instancia, quería brindar una vida mejor para mí, mi esposa y mis hijos.
Reconocer que esta era mi motivación hizo que esos sacrificios fueran mucho más fáciles.
Cualquiera que sea su motivación, sea cual sea su motivo, téngalo en cuenta.
Cuando las cosas se pongan difíciles y tenga ganas de rendirse, recuerde la razón por la que comenzó en primer lugar .
Integre su aprendizaje en diferentes áreas de su vida
El aprendizaje viene en todas las formas y tamaños. Por ejemplo, un error común es que si quieres aprender a codificar, tienes que estar sentado frente a una computadora. No me malinterpretes, ciertamente ayuda, pero a menudo hay otras áreas de tu vida que puedes aprovechar para maximizar y apoyar tu aprendizaje.
Mientras estaba aprendiendo a codificar, trabajando en mi trabajo de construcción de tiempo completo, tenía un viaje diario al trabajo de al menos una hora. Qué 'pérdida' de tiempo ... ¡pero no tenía que ser así!
Comencé a escuchar podcasts motivacionales relacionados con el desarrollo web y los negocios durante mi viaje. Si bien no aprenden directamente, los podcasts son una forma brillante de consumir contenido pasivamente y una excelente manera de obtener más contexto en torno al área de aprendizaje elegida.
Aproveche todas las oportunidades que tenga y sumérjase en la búsqueda que elija. Cambie música por podcasts mientras está en el gimnasio, lea un capítulo de un libro relevante o una publicación de blog durante la pausa del almuerzo, lleve consigo un bloc de notas y tome notas cuando se le ocurran pensamientos e ideas.
Encuentre formas en las que pueda hacer que el aprendizaje sea parte de su vida diaria. Piensa fuera de la caja.
No te presiones demasiado
Esta es también una de las conclusiones más importantes de mi experiencia de aprender a codificar.
En cierta contradicción con mi primer punto acerca de que la consistencia es clave, también debes comprender que esto es vida y que la vida no es sencilla. Incluso los planes mejor diseñados no siempre funcionan.
Entonces, no se castigue por eso. Si pierdes un día estudiando, ¿y qué? En el gran esquema de las cosas, ¡un día perdido aquí y allá no hará la menor diferencia! Recógelo al día siguiente y sigue avanzando. El extraño día perdido realmente no va a importar.
Esto se aplica también a quedarse despierto hasta tarde o forzarlo demasiado. Si estás cansado, ¡vete a dormir! Si necesitas salir por la noche con la familia, ve a divertirte. La vida es demasiado corta.
Se paciente
Aprender cualquier cosa llevará tiempo y las cosas no suceden de la noche a la mañana.
Si bien el objetivo es siempre ser productivo y aprender tanto como sea posible lo más rápido posible, solo necesita recordar que estará en esto a largo plazo y todo irá bien con el tiempo.
Con demasiada frecuencia nos preocupa que las cosas estén tardando demasiado, no estamos progresando lo suficiente y nunca alcanzaremos nuestro objetivo. Lo entiendo completamente, especialmente en el caso del desarrollo web. Debido a que hay mucho que aprender y el alcance es tan vasto, a veces puede resultar abrumador.
Pero estamos hablando de algo que podría materializarse en una carrera que podría abarcar los próximos 10, 20, 30 o 40 años.
Nuevamente, póngalo en perspectiva: si le toma 1 año, 2 años, 3 años o incluso más conseguir su primer trabajo. ¿Eso realmente importa?
Por alguna razón, en el mundo del desarrollo autodidacta, parece que todo se trata de cómo alguien 'consiguió un trabajo en 6 meses' o 'consiguió un puesto junior de $ 100 mil'.
Pero recuerde, no siempre obtenemos el contexto completo que rodea esa situación. Al final del día, esa es la historia de otra persona, no la tuya. Siempre que esté avanzando y progresando, sucederá. Se paciente.
No te compares con los demás. Compárate con la persona que eras ayer
No hay ningún ingrediente secreto. Sacrificio, trabajo duro y paciencia es todo lo que se necesita.
¡Gracias por leer! ? Si lo disfrutó, presione el botón de aplaudir a continuación. Realmente aprecio su apoyo y ayuda a otras personas a ver la historia.
Siempre estoy feliz de escuchar a personas de ideas afines, así que no dudes en enviarme un correo electrónico o saludarme en Twitter.
También me gustaría aprovechar esta oportunidad para agradecer enormemente a Quincy Larson por reconocerme como uno de los principales contribuyentes de freeCodeCamp. Sin Quincy y la plataforma freeCodeCamp, no habría sido posible llegar, hablar e interactuar con tantas personas como lo hice el año pasado. Gracias a toda la comunidad freeCodeCamp, a todos los que les gusta, comparten, apoyan y contribuyen a hacer de la comunidad lo que es. ¡Todos son increíbles!